Luhuramunda in context
With 950 people at the 2011 Census, Luhuramunda was the 520th most populous of its district's 1783 villages, above the district average of 814.
The sex ratio was 1043 women per 1,000 men (51 above the district's rural figure of 992) — one of the minority of villages where women outnumbered men.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 1473, 550 above the rural national 923.
